React Component Lifecycle Methods 소개 🚀
React Component Lifecycle Methods 소개 🚀 안녕하세요, 웹 개발에 관심 있는 모든 분들! 오늘은 React에서 매우 중요한 개념 중 하나인 Component Lifecycle Methods에 대해 알아보려고 합니다. React를 사용하여 웹 애플리케이션을 개발할 때, 우리는 컴포넌트를 많이 사용합니다. 이 컴포넌트들은 생성부터 소멸까지 여러 단계를 거치게 되는데, 이러한 과정을 더 잘 이해하고 제어할 수 있게 도와주는 것이 바로 Lifecycle Methods입니다. 🌱 컴포넌트의 탄생: Mounting 컴포넌트가 화면에 나타나기 시작하는 단계를 'Mounting'이라고 합니다. 이 단계에서는 주로 컴포넌트를 초기화하고, 필요한 데이터를 불러오는 작업을 합니다. 🔄 컴포넌트의 업데이트 컴포넌트의 상태(state)나 속성(props)이 변경되면, 컴포넌트는 업데이트 과정을 거치게 됩니다. 이 과정에서는 변경된 데이터를 화면에 반영하기 위한 작업이 이루어집니다. 💀 컴포넌트의 죽음: Unmounting 마지막으로, 컴포넌트가 더 이상 필요하지 않아 화면에서 사라지는 단계를 'Unmounting'이라고 합니다. 이 단계에서는 컴포넌트가 사용했던 자원을 정리(clean-up)하는 작업을 주로 합니다. 이상으로 React의 Component Lifecycle Methods에 대한 간단한 소개를 마칩니다. 이 메소드들을 잘 이해하고 사용하면, 컴포넌트의 생명주기를 효과적으로 관리하면서 더욱 효율적인 애플리케이션을 만들 수 있습니다. 여러분의 React 여정에 이 정보가 도움이 되길 바랍니다! 🚀
a year ago